| Package | Description |
|---|---|
| io.envoyproxy.envoy.config.core.v4alpha | |
| io.envoyproxy.envoy.extensions.tracers.xray.v4alpha |
| Modifier and Type | Method and Description |
|---|---|
SocketAddress.Builder |
SocketAddress.Builder.addR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
SocketAddress.Builder |
SocketAddress.Builder.clear() |
SocketAddress.Builder |
SocketAddress.Builder.clearAddress()
The address for this socket.
|
SocketAddress.Builder |
SocketAddress.Builder.clearField(com.google.protobuf.Descriptors.FieldDescriptor field) |
SocketAddress.Builder |
SocketAddress.Builder.clearIpv4Compat()
When binding to an IPv6 address above, this enables `IPv4 compatibility
<https://tools.ietf.org/html/rfc3493#page-11>`_.
|
SocketAddress.Builder |
SocketAddress.Builder.clearNamedPort()
This is only valid if :ref:`resolver_name
<envoy_api_field_config.core.v4alpha.SocketAddress.resolver_name>` is specified below and the
named resolver is capable of named port resolution.
|
SocketAddress.Builder |
SocketAddress.Builder.clearOneof(com.google.protobuf.Descriptors.OneofDescriptor oneof) |
SocketAddress.Builder |
SocketAddress.Builder.clearPortSpecifier() |
SocketAddress.Builder |
SocketAddress.Builder.clearPortValue()
uint32 port_value = 3 [(.validate.rules) = { ... } |
SocketAddress.Builder |
SocketAddress.Builder.clearProtocol()
.envoy.config.core.v4alpha.SocketAddress.Protocol protocol = 1 [(.validate.rules) = { ... } |
SocketAddress.Builder |
SocketAddress.Builder.clearResolverName()
The name of the custom resolver.
|
SocketAddress.Builder |
SocketAddress.Builder.clone() |
SocketAddress.Builder |
Address.Builder.getSocketAddressBuilder()
.envoy.config.core.v4alpha.SocketAddress socket_address = 1; |
SocketAddress.Builder |
BindConfig.Builder.getSourceAddressBuilder()
The address to bind to when creating a socket.
|
SocketAddress.Builder |
SocketAddress.Builder.mergeF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
SocketAddress.Builder |
SocketAddress.Builder.mergeFrom(com.google.protobuf.Message other) |
SocketAddress.Builder |
SocketAddress.Builder.mergeFrom(SocketAddress other) |
SocketAddress.Builder |
SocketAddress.Builder.mergeU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
static SocketAddress.Builder |
SocketAddress.newBuilder() |
static SocketAddress.Builder |
SocketAddress.newBuilder(SocketAddress prototype) |
SocketAddress.Builder |
SocketAddress.newBuilderForType() |
protected SocketAddress.Builder |
SocketAddress.newBuilderForType(com.google.protobuf.GeneratedMessageV3.BuilderParent parent) |
SocketAddress.Builder |
SocketAddress.Builder.setAddress(String value)
The address for this socket.
|
SocketAddress.Builder |
SocketAddress.Builder.setAddressBytes(com.google.protobuf.ByteString value)
The address for this socket.
|
SocketAddress.Builder |
SocketAddress.Builder.setField(com.google.protobuf.Descriptors.FieldDescriptor field,
Object value) |
SocketAddress.Builder |
SocketAddress.Builder.setIpv4Compat(boolean value)
When binding to an IPv6 address above, this enables `IPv4 compatibility
<https://tools.ietf.org/html/rfc3493#page-11>`_.
|
SocketAddress.Builder |
SocketAddress.Builder.setNamedPort(String value)
This is only valid if :ref:`resolver_name
<envoy_api_field_config.core.v4alpha.SocketAddress.resolver_name>` is specified below and the
named resolver is capable of named port resolution.
|
SocketAddress.Builder |
SocketAddress.Builder.setNamedPortBytes(com.google.protobuf.ByteString value)
This is only valid if :ref:`resolver_name
<envoy_api_field_config.core.v4alpha.SocketAddress.resolver_name>` is specified below and the
named resolver is capable of named port resolution.
|
SocketAddress.Builder |
SocketAddress.Builder.setPortValue(int value)
uint32 port_value = 3 [(.validate.rules) = { ... } |
SocketAddress.Builder |
SocketAddress.Builder.setProtocol(SocketAddress.Protocol value)
.envoy.config.core.v4alpha.SocketAddress.Protocol protocol = 1 [(.validate.rules) = { ... } |
SocketAddress.Builder |
SocketAddress.Builder.setProtocolValue(int value)
.envoy.config.core.v4alpha.SocketAddress.Protocol protocol = 1 [(.validate.rules) = { ... } |
SocketAddress.Builder |
SocketAddress.Builder.setRepeatedField(com.google.protobuf.Descriptors.FieldDescriptor field,
int index,
Object value) |
SocketAddress.Builder |
SocketAddress.Builder.setResolverName(String value)
The name of the custom resolver.
|
SocketAddress.Builder |
SocketAddress.Builder.setResolverNameBytes(com.google.protobuf.ByteString value)
The name of the custom resolver.
|
SocketAddress.Builder |
SocketAddress.Builder.setUnknownFields(com.google.protobuf.UnknownFieldSet unknownFields) |
SocketAddress.Builder |
SocketAddress.toBuilder() |
| Modifier and Type | Method and Description |
|---|---|
Address.Builder |
Address.Builder.setSocketAddress(SocketAddress.Builder builderForValue)
.envoy.config.core.v4alpha.SocketAddress socket_address = 1; |
BindConfig.Builder |
BindConfig.Builder.setSourceAddress(SocketAddress.Builder builderForValue)
The address to bind to when creating a socket.
|
| Modifier and Type | Method and Description |
|---|---|
SocketAddress.Builder |
XRayConfig.Builder.getDaemonEndpointBuilder()
The UDP endpoint of the X-Ray Daemon where the spans will be sent.
|
| Modifier and Type | Method and Description |
|---|---|
XRayConfig.Builder |
XRayConfig.Builder.setDaemonEndpoint(SocketAddress.Builder builderForValue)
The UDP endpoint of the X-Ray Daemon where the spans will be sent.
|
Copyright © 2018–2021 The Envoy Project. All rights reserved.